Brazilian Jiu Jitsu is a ground based grappling technique that involves the use of joint locks and chokeholds. Brazilian Jiu Jitsu BJJ promotes the concept that a smaller, weaker person can successfully defend themselves or another against a bigger, stronger, heavier assailant by using proper technique and leverage. BJJ is an amazing first martial art to learn because of the amazing self-defense it provides. Unlike boxing or Muay Thai, Jiu Jitsu does not allow strikes.

This is followed by a lecture in technique, and students practicing that technique again and again. BJJ is a lot of repetition, and also figuring out how to use each position as an advantage against your opponent. That depends on how much you value grappling and ground techniques. There are many defensive techniques that are taught in Brazilian Jiu Jitsu that are very useful for a real-life situation. Jiu Jitsu schools can vary wildly. Jujitsu was first developed by the Samurai. The softness employs balance, leverage and momentum. It focuses on grappling, throws, pins and joint locks with as little energy expended as possible. Some moves, if learned correctly, can seriously injure your opponent with one blow. Some tactics like gouging, biting and poking are taught. Jujitsu is effective in close-quarter combat. It is suited for people who like its aggressive nature.

The anything goes aspect it teaches would be beneficial in a real life or death situation. However, like Krav Maga, the ruthlessness might deter some people. The origin of Eskrima predates the Spanish invasion of the Philippines in It emphasizes weapons like sticks, knives and swords for use in battle. Footwork is an important component. Intricate stances and stable low positions are important. Its philosophy is to teach very simple, basic skills. This philosophy of simplicity is important since only effective, easy skills that could be taught in large groups were used.

Eskrima is good for those that want an emphasis on balance, focus and adaptability. These are very good skills to learn for everyday life. The ability to work with various weapons appeals to many people. The philosophy of simplicity is another reason people are drawn to it.

Kung Fu is one of the oldest martial arts in the world. Chinese Emperor Huangdi, who started reigning in BC, is said to have introduced this martial art to his soldiers as part of their training.

Kung Fu literally means an accomplishment gained through hard, long work. Technique varies across the styles of Kung Fu, but most use grappling, throwing, kicks and punches.

The use of weapons is also common. Since Kung Fu has so many styles, it is easy for someone to find one that will suit them. The emphasis on so many types of attacks is a good all around way to train every part of the body. Kung fu is renowned for its beautiful and flowing form.
